To the Administrator Addressed (TAA) Correspondence

College, Career, and Military Readiness (CCMR) Verifier

Overview

The purpose of this communication is to inform school systems that the College, Career, and Military Readiness (CCMR) Verifier is now available on the Performance Reporting tab within the Accountability application until June 26, 2026. The CCMR Verifier One-Pager provides information on the tool's purpose, how to use it, and how to check a request if one is submitted.

Districts should use the CCMR Verifier to verify the accuracy of their non-TSDS PEIMS CCMR data, which will be included in 2026 accountability ratings. CCMR data are shown for 2024–25 annual graduates and non-graduating 12th graders. While CCMR indicators determined by TSDS PEIMS submissions are not eligible for corrections within the CCMR Verifier application, data from the TSDS PEIMS elements are shown through the Preliminary CCMR Student Listing linked within the CCMR Verifier application.

Eligible for corrections (data from vendors and other sources) and shown on the CCMR Verifier:

  • ACT college admissions tests
  • Advanced Placement (AP) examinations
  • International Baccalaureate (IB) examinations
  • Texas Success Initiative Assessment (TSIA) tests
  • SAT college admissions tests
  • OnRamps dual enrollment course completion
  • Level I or Level II certificates*
  • DD Form 4 (military enlistment)

*Do not submit Industry-Based Certification (IBC) documentation through the Level I or II certificates field.

Not eligible for corrections (district submissions via TSDS PEIMS) and not shown on the CCMR Verifier:

  • Graduate with completed individualized education program and workforce readiness 
  • Graduate with Advanced Diploma Plan and current special education student 
  • College prep course completion
  • Dual credit course completion
  • Industry-Based Certification (IBC)
  • Associate degree

If no discrepancies are found, no action is required. Districts can submit official documentation to correct data by June 26, 2026. The requirements for acceptable documentation can be found in the 2026 CCMR Verifier Data Requirements. Districts should keep track of their request in the CCMR Verifier application to determine if the request has been approved or denied. Ä¢¹½ÊÓÆµ»ÆÆ¬ may request additional documents or actions of the district after an initial review. As such, districts are encouraged to submit requests prior to the deadline, as only complete and correct submissions received by June 26, 2026, will be included in 2026 accountability ratings.

Working Submissions 

Districts may submit PEIMS Working Submissions for the 2023-24 and 2024-25 school years. Data submissions with errors from the 2025 PEIMS Fall Submission may also be corrected through a Working Submission. Only Working Submissions with validated corrections related to CCMR indicators will be considered for accountability ratings, beginning with 2026 accountability ratings.

The eligible CCMR indicators that can be corrected through a PEIMS Working Submission include:

  • College Preparatory Course Completion
  • Dual Credit Course Completion
  • Industry-Based Certifications (IBC)
  • Program of Study Completer elements
  • Associate Degree attainment
  • Diploma Type values for reported graduates with completed IEP and workforce readiness
  • Diploma Type and Endorsement values for reported graduates earning an advanced diploma and who were served within Special Education Programs

All PEIMS Working Submissions must be confirmed, as indicated via email from TSDS PEIMS, by June 26, 2026, to be included in 2026 accountability ratings calculations. For additional information on requirements for submitting a working submission, please reference the PEIMS Working Submission Guidance document. It is strongly recommended that complete Working Submissions with correct reports be sent by June 12, 2026. Submissions initiated after this date may not be processed in time for 2026 accountability ratings if sent incomplete.
